Research homeowner association fees, restrictions, and amenities before purchasing. Request recent financial statements from the HOA to understand reserve funds and pending assessments. Visit communities during different times to observe security protocols and maintenance standards. Review architectural guidelines limiting exterior modifications. Verify gate access policies for guests and service providers. Inspect shared amenities like pools, fitness centers, and clubhouses. Consider resale value and community reputation when evaluating investment potential.

Monterey Park is a vibrant, multicultural community in Los Angeles County known for excellent schools, diverse dining, and strong economic vitality. Home to significant Asian-American populations, the city offers authentic restaurants, markets, and cultural events celebrating its heritage. The area boasts proximity to Pasadena, San Gabriel, and Downtown LA, making it ideal for commuters. Landmark parks, golf courses, and shopping districts enhance lifestyle appeal.
